Job Description:

We are seeking a Systems Administrator to join our IT Support Services team. The Systems Administrator will be responsible for administering, developing, testing, implementing, and maintaining operating systems and related software for the DC Child Support Enforcement System, ensuring its smooth operation and functionality.

Key Responsibilities:

System Administration: Administer, develop, and maintain operating systems and related software for the DC Child Support Enforcement System, ensuring optimal performance and reliability.

Standards Establishment: Establish and implement standards for computer operations to ensure compatibility between hardware and software, according to specifications and parameters.

Troubleshooting: Troubleshoot and resolve software, operating system, and networking problems, providing timely and effective solutions to minimize downtime.

Backup and Recovery: Schedule, perform, and monitor system backups, and perform data recoveries as necessary to safeguard critical information.

Hardware and Software Upgrades: Recommend hardware and software upgrades based on growth statistics and disk space forecasts, and schedule and perform system upgrades as needed.

Task Scheduling: Schedule tasks using software support tools and scripts to automate routine processes and improve efficiency.

Configuration: Configure hardware, including workstations, printers, servers, and tape devices, to ensure proper functionality and compatibility.

Technical Support: Provide technical support and assistance to system users, addressing inquiries, troubleshooting issues, and offering guidance on system usage.
